About the area
Maastricht, Netherlands is a delightful city that presents a harmonious blend of history, culture, and contemporary conveniences. While it has a long history dating back to Roman times, it's important to note that there are other cities in the Netherlands like Nijmegen that have evidence of habitation from even earlier periods. Nevertheless, Maastricht's historical significance is undeniable, as seen in its well-preserved medieval structures such as the Basilica of Saint Servatius and the iconic city walls.
The cultural scene in Maastricht is lively and varied. The Bonnefanten Museum houses an extensive collection of old masters and modern art pieces while the Maastricht Theatre serves as a stage for diverse performances. The city also celebrates numerous festivals annually, including the renowned Carnival in February.
The culinary offerings in Maastricht are just as impressive. With several Michelin-starred restaurants and countless quaint cafes serving traditional Dutch cuisine, food enthusiasts will be spoilt for choice. A visit to the local market is also recommended for its fresh produce and local specialties.
Nature enthusiasts will find much to love about Maastricht's green spaces. The city park features lovely walking trails and picnic spots while nearby hills offer hiking and biking opportunities with breathtaking views over the city.
For shopping aficionados, Maastricht presents a variety of high-end boutiques and unique independent shops with Wyck district being particularly famous for its stylish stores.
